Where I Live
In my innermost being
Where I live,
My life comes from my soul.
I struggle along in this outer shell
Ever mindful
That my life is within.
The pain that I carry
In this body of mine
The joys it experiences.
Are the markings of time.
Each day unfolds
With mysteries it holds
Waiting for me
To see the beauty it molds
The clouds in the sky
The birds in the trees
The snow on the ground
And each gentle breeze
Tell of God's glory
That lives in nature and me.
The indwelling Spirit
That sets us free
That’s MY inner most being
And I'm glad I'm ME.
